South India Pharma Sector’s Dependence on MgCl₂

Introduction

South India has become a powerhouse of pharmaceutical manufacturing, with major hubs in Hyderabad, Chennai, Bangalore, and Visakhapatnam. These cities host a large concentration of API manufacturers, formulation companies, biotech firms, and contract research organizations (CROs).

Within this ecosystem, Magnesium Chloride (MgCl₂) plays a vital role as both a process chemical and a pharmaceutical-grade ingredient, supporting everything from drug formulation and synthesis to water purification and quality control. This blog explains why the South India pharma sector depends heavily on MgCl₂ and how its demand continues to grow.


Overview of South India Pharma Industry

South India contributes a significant share of India’s pharmaceutical output due to:

  • Strong API manufacturing base
  • Advanced R&D infrastructure
  • Export-oriented production
  • Presence of global pharma companies

Key Pharma Clusters:

  • Genome Valley (Hyderabad)
  • Jeedimetla & Patancheru (Telangana)
  • Sriperumbudur & Chennai industrial belt
  • Peenya & Electronic City (Bangalore)
  • Vizag Pharma City (Visakhapatnam)

These clusters create consistent demand for high-purity chemical inputs like MgCl₂.

Key Applications of MgCl₂ in South India Pharma Sector

1. Electrolyte Formulations and IV Solutions

MgCl₂ is a key ingredient in:

  • Intravenous fluids
  • Electrolyte solutions
  • Critical care medicines

Benefits:

  • Maintains electrolyte balance
  • Supports nerve and muscle function
  • Essential in hospital treatments

2. Pharmaceutical Intermediates and API Production

In API manufacturing, MgCl₂ is used in:

  • Chemical synthesis
  • Reaction processes
  • Intermediate production

Impact:

  • Improves reaction efficiency
  • Enhances product consistency
  • Supports large-scale production

3. Injectable and Parenteral Drugs

MgCl₂ is used in:

  • Injectable formulations
  • Emergency medicines
  • Therapeutic treatments

Advantages:

  • High purity
  • Fast absorption
  • Reliable clinical performance

4. Nutraceuticals and Supplements

The growing nutraceutical industry uses MgCl₂ in:

  • Magnesium tablets and capsules
  • Health supplements
  • Dietary formulations

5. Buffering and Stabilizing Agent

MgCl₂ helps in:

  • Maintaining pH balance
  • Stabilizing formulations
  • Improving shelf life

6. Biotech and Research Applications

South India’s biotech labs use MgCl₂ in:

  • Cell culture media
  • Enzyme reactions
  • Molecular biology processes

7. Water Treatment in Pharma Plants

Pharma manufacturing requires ultra-pure water.

MgCl₂ is used in:

  • Effluent Treatment Plants (ETPs)
  • Water purification systems
  • Sludge treatment

Supply Chain Supporting Pharma Sector

Key Supply Sources:

  • Gujarat chemical belt
  • Maharashtra industrial hubs
  • Imports via Chennai and Vizag ports

Distribution:

  • Bulk supply to pharma companies
  • Contract-based procurement
  • Local distributors and chemical suppliers
